Abstract

Local ancient manuscripts represent a significant cultural heritage asset, imbued with immense historical, cultural, and intellectual value. Nevertheless, the undertaking of preservation and conservation is frequently impeded by the dearth of requisite resources. The objective of this study is to identify the most effective minimal conservation strategies for the preservation of regional ancient manuscripts. The research method employed is a literature review, which analyses sources from national and international journals, conference proceedings, and books related to the preservation and conservation of ancient manuscripts. The findings reveal several minimal preservation steps, including physical cleaning of manuscripts, inventory management, designing proper storage, digitising manuscripts using simple equipment, and establishing community groups to empower local communities with an understanding of the importance of managing cultural manuscripts. These strategies can be implemented with affordable costs and limited resources while ensuring the preservation of regional ancient manuscripts as valuable cultural heritage. This study offers practical recommendations for individuals and communities owning ancient manuscripts and provides insights for community leaders and stakeholders to support the preservation of regional ancient manuscripts.
